What companies run services between Cobh, Ireland and Maynooth, Ireland?

Iarnród Éireann (Irish Rail) operates a train from Cork to Dublin Heuston hourly. Tickets cost €22–35 and the journey takes 2h 28m. Alternatively, Citylink operates a bus from Cork Alfred Street to Parkgate Street every 2 hours. Tickets cost €22–30 and the journey takes 2h 50m.
